BURLINGTON, Iowa (AP) - A southeast Iowa man has been charged with murder, accused of killing his 22-day-old son last fall.
Officers arrested 22-year-old Randall Payne at his rural Burlington home on Wednesday evening. Des Moines County Sheriff Mike Johnstone says Payne is charged with first-degree murder and other felony crimes. Online court records don’t list the name of an attorney who could be contacted to comment on Payne’s behalf.
The Hawk Eye (https://bit.ly/1e2YLeI ) reports that the body of Carter Joseph Payne was found by emergency crews after they responded to his father’s 911 call on Nov. 9. Johnstone says the boy’s mother and 1-year-old sibling were not home at the time of the infant’s death.
The sheriff says investigators waited until all autopsy reports were completed before arresting Payne.
